DUNCAN v. DRIPPING SPRINGS, ETC.

No. 13429.

612 S.W.2d 644 (1981)

William S. DUNCAN, Relator, v. DRIPPING SPRINGS INDEPENDENT SCHOOL DISTRICT et al., Respondents.

Court of Civil Appeals of Texas, Austin.

January 30, 1981.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Waggoner Carr, Ken E. Mackey, Austin, for relator.

Doren Eskew, Austin, for respondents.


PER CURIAM.
